分布式服务框架:原理与实践,基于分布式服务框架的原理与实践,构建高效分部署服务器平台与数据摆渡网络架构图解析
- 综合资讯
- 2024-12-01 21:20:48
- 2

本内容探讨了分布式服务框架的原理与实践,旨在构建高效分布式服务器平台与数据摆渡网络架构。通过解析框架原理,阐述如何实现高效的数据传输与服务器部署。...
本内容探讨了分布式服务框架的原理与实践,旨在构建高效分布式服务器平台与数据摆渡网络架构。通过解析框架原理,阐述如何实现高效的数据传输与服务器部署。
随着互联网技术的飞速发展,分布式服务框架(Distributed Service Framework,简称DSF)已经成为现代企业构建高效、可扩展、高可用服务系统的重要手段,本文将围绕分布式服务框架的原理与实践,深入探讨其应用在分部署服务器平台与数据摆渡网络架构图中的关键技术,为读者提供一份全面、实用的参考。
分布式服务框架原理
1、分布式服务框架概述
分布式服务框架是一种将应用程序分解为多个服务模块,通过网络进行通信,实现高可用、可扩展、易维护的架构模式,其主要特点包括:
(1)服务化:将应用程序分解为多个独立的服务模块,每个模块负责特定的功能。
(2)网络通信:服务模块之间通过网络进行通信,实现跨地域、跨平台的数据交换。
(3)高可用:通过服务副本、负载均衡等技术,提高系统稳定性和可靠性。
(4)可扩展:根据业务需求,动态调整服务模块的数量和配置。
2、分布式服务框架核心组件
(1)服务注册与发现:实现服务模块的注册、发现和动态更新。
(2)服务路由:根据请求内容,将请求分发到对应的服务模块。
(3)负载均衡:根据负载情况,合理分配请求到各个服务模块。
(4)服务监控与运维:实时监控服务状态,及时发现和处理故障。
分部署服务器平台
1、分部署服务器平台概述
分部署服务器平台是指将应用程序部署在多个物理或虚拟服务器上,通过分布式服务框架实现服务模块的高可用、可扩展,其主要优势包括:
(1)提高系统性能:通过分布式部署,实现负载均衡,提高系统响应速度。
(2)降低单点故障风险:将应用程序分解为多个服务模块,降低单点故障风险。
(3)灵活扩展:根据业务需求,动态调整服务模块的数量和配置。
2、分部署服务器平台关键技术
(1)虚拟化技术:采用虚拟化技术,实现物理服务器到虚拟服务器的转换。
(2)容器技术:利用容器技术,实现服务模块的快速部署、管理和扩展。
(3)分布式存储:采用分布式存储技术,实现数据的高效存储和访问。
(4)服务注册与发现:通过服务注册与发现,实现服务模块的动态更新和路由。
数据摆渡网络架构
1、数据摆渡网络架构概述
数据摆渡网络架构是指通过分布式服务框架,实现数据在不同服务模块之间的高效传输,其主要优势包括:
(1)提高数据传输效率:通过分布式服务框架,实现数据的高速传输。
(2)降低数据传输成本:通过优化网络传输路径,降低数据传输成本。
(3)提高数据安全性:采用数据加密、访问控制等技术,确保数据安全。
2、数据摆渡网络架构关键技术
(1)数据同步:采用数据同步技术,实现数据在不同服务模块之间的实时更新。
(2)数据压缩:采用数据压缩技术,降低数据传输带宽需求。
(3)数据加密:采用数据加密技术,确保数据在传输过程中的安全性。
(4)网络优化:通过优化网络传输路径,提高数据传输效率。
本文从分布式服务框架的原理与实践出发,深入探讨了其在分部署服务器平台与数据摆渡网络架构中的应用,通过分布式服务框架,企业可以实现服务模块的高可用、可扩展,提高系统性能和稳定性,在实际应用中,企业应根据自身业务需求,选择合适的技术方案,构建高效、稳定的分布式服务系统。
本文链接:https://www.zhitaoyun.cn/1246607.html
发表评论